  "textContent": "Japan’s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ry (Meti) has proposed rebuilding between two and ​five of its nuclear reactors by the 2040s and then up to 11 to 14 by the 2050s.\n\nThe post Japan to rebuild 14 nuclear reactors by 2050 appeared first on New Civil Engineer.",
